Which best describes a way people can use personal loans?

Personal loans are a popular financial tool that provides individuals with the flexibility to address a wide range of needs and goals. Whether you’re looking to consolidate debt, finance home improvements, cover unexpected medical expenses, or plan a special event, personal loans can be a valuable resource. In this article, we will delve into the versatile uses of personal loans and how they can help you achieve your financial objectives.

Debt Consolidation:

One common use of personal loans is debt consolidation. If you have multiple high-interest debts, such as credit card balances or outstanding loans, consolidating them into a single personal loan can simplify your finances. By obtaining a personal loan with a lower interest rate, you can pay off your existing debts and focus on a single monthly payment, potentially saving money on interest over time.

Home Improvements:

Personal loans are an excellent option for financing home improvement projects. Whether you want to renovate your kitchen, upgrade your bathroom, or add an extension to your home, a personal loan can provide the necessary funds. You can use the loan to cover the costs of materials, labor, and other expenses associated with the project.

Medical Expenses:

Unexpected medical bills can put a strain on your finances. Personal loans can help cover medical expenses that are not fully covered by insurance or for treatments that are not covered at all. Whether it’s a dental procedure, elective surgery, or other healthcare costs, a personal loan can provide the financial support you need to manage these expenses.

Special Events:

Personal loans can be used to fund special events and occasions such as weddings, engagements, birthdays, or vacations. These events often involve significant expenses, and a personal loan can help you create memorable experiences without straining your immediate finances. From booking venues to purchasing wedding rings or financing your dream vacation, a personal loan can make these events more accessible.

Personal loans can be used to fund education-related expenses, such as tuition fees, textbooks, or educational courses. Whether you’re pursuing higher education or taking professional development courses, a personal loan can bridge the financial gap and provide you with the means to invest in your education and future career prospects.

Vehicle Purchase:

If you’re in need of a new or used vehicle, a personal loan can help you finance the purchase. Rather than depleting your savings or relying solely on dealership financing, a personal loan can provide an alternative funding source with competitive interest rates and favorable repayment terms.

Emergency Situations:

Life is unpredictable, and unexpected emergencies can arise at any time. Whether it’s a major car repair, home repair, or urgent travel expenses, personal loans can offer a lifeline during these challenging times. Having access to funds through a personal loan can help you address these emergencies quickly and avoid financial stress.

Business Ventures:

Personal loans can also be used to fund small business initiatives or startups. If you’re an entrepreneur looking to launch a new business or expand an existing one, a personal loan can provide the necessary capital. It can help cover startup costs, purchase equipment, hire employees, or invest in marketing efforts.

Before applying for a personal loan, it’s important to assess your financial situation, determine the loan amount you need, and consider your ability to repay the loan.
